| Loureiro Engineering Associates is seeking a Reality Capture Specialist to support our Building Information Modeling (BIM) and point cloud data processing efforts. This role is key to creating detailed, accurate digital twins from laser-scanned point clouds for a variety of architecture, engineering, and construction (AEC) projects. The Reality Capture Specialist will enable efficient design, planning, and construction by providing precise site conditions within a BIM environment.
